
写在前面
WMS 选型最常见的问题,不是“系统功能不够多”,而是项目一开始就没有把边界说清楚。
在实际项目里,企业往往会同时提到这些诉求:
- 想提高收货、拣货、盘点效率
- 想把 ERP、MES、快递、自动化设备接起来
- 想做多仓、多货主、批次与序列号管理
- 还希望顺手把仓库现场流程一起规范掉
这些诉求本身没有问题,但如果不先区分“系统能力”和“实施工作”,WMS 选型就很容易变成一场无效比较。最后买回来的不是不够用,就是实施周期和预算失控。
本文不讨论“哪家厂商最好”,而是给出一套更适合项目评估阶段使用的判断方法。

图:WMS 选型真正要看的不是菜单数量,而是仓库对象、作业范围和执行边界能不能在系统里落得住。
一、先判断:你的问题是不是应该由 WMS 解决
WMS 适合解决的是仓储执行层问题,包括:
- 入库、上架、拣货、复核、发运等作业链路
- 库位、批次、序列号、库存状态等执行数据
- PDA 扫码、任务分派、作业回传等现场动作
- 与 ERP、MES、TMS、WCS 的执行数据衔接
如果当前主要问题是:
- 采购计划经常变更
- 销售预测不准
- 供应商协同效率低
- 运输调度长期失控
那就不应指望 WMS 单独解决。WMS 可以承接执行,但不能替代上游计划管理。
简单说,WMS 负责把仓库“做对、做快、做可追溯”,不负责替代企业所有供应链系统。
二、选型前必须先画清项目边界
真正影响选型结果的,不是宣传页里的功能清单,而是下面这四类边界。
1. 仓库对象边界
先明确你要管理的是哪种仓:
- 制造业原料仓、半成品仓、成品仓
- 电商履约仓
- 第三方物流多货主仓
- 自动化仓或人工与自动化混合作业仓
不同仓型决定了系统重点完全不同。比如制造仓强调齐套、批次和生产衔接,电商仓强调订单分波与时效,3PL 仓强调多货主隔离和计费口径。
2. 作业范围边界
至少要确认下面这些范围是否在本次项目内:
- 入库通知、收货、质检、上架
- 波次、拣货、复核、发运
- 盘点、移库、冻结、调整
- 补货、预警、库位策略
- 报表、看板、运营分析
很多项目延期,不是因为系统做不出来,而是这些范围在实施中途持续扩张。
3. 接口边界
选型阶段就要列出真实对接对象,而不是只写一句“支持集成”。
常见接口包括:
- ERP:采购单、销售单、库存同步
- MES:生产领料、产成品入库、工单状态
- TMS / 快递平台:运单、面单、物流状态
- WCS / AGV / 输送线:任务下发、状态回传、异常反馈
如果接口对象、字段口径和责任归属没有确认,后面再强的系统也会被拖慢。
4. 交付边界
需要提前问清楚,供应商交付的究竟是:
- 标准产品 + 参数配置
- 标准产品 + 适量定制
- 深度行业方案 + 项目化实施
这三种模式的预算、周期、风险完全不同。选型时如果把三类方案放在一起比价,结果通常不具参考意义。
三、建议重点看这五个维度
1. 业务适配能力
重点不是看“功能多少”,而是看系统能不能覆盖你最关键的 10 个场景。
建议至少要求供应商围绕以下内容做演示:
- 一条完整入库链路
- 一条完整出库链路
- 一次盘点或移库处理
- 一次异常处理,例如短收、破损、波次回退
- 一次接口回传或单据状态联动
如果演示只停留在菜单切换和通用表单,很难说明系统是否真正贴近业务。
2. 实施方法是否清楚
WMS 项目不是单纯的软件安装,更接近“系统 + 流程 + 数据 + 现场”的联合落地。
成熟项目通常会有清晰的实施阶段:
在选型阶段,建议直接问供应商:
- 需求是怎么确认的
- 蓝图和差距分析谁负责
- 主数据谁来整理
- 联测和试运行怎么安排
- 上线切换有哪些前置条件
如果这些问题没有明确回答,后续项目风险通常不低。
3. 接口与扩展能力
很多 WMS 方案在标准流程上表现不错,但一涉及集成就容易暴露短板。
重点要看:
- 是否提供稳定的 API 或消息机制
- 是否支持异步回传和失败重试
- 是否能记录接口日志和业务追踪
- 是否支持多系统并行对接
对于自动化仓项目,还要额外看任务状态设计、异常回退和人工接管机制。
4. 数据基础和主数据治理
如果 SKU、库位、批次规则、货主、包装单位这些主数据本身就不稳定,再好的 WMS 也很难上线顺利。
选型时可以顺手评估企业当前的数据准备程度:
- SKU 编码是否统一
- 包装单位是否清楚
- 库位规则是否完整
- 批次和序列号是否需要严格管理
- 历史库存是否可核对
很多项目的问题并不在系统,而在数据基础不具备上线条件。
5. 供应商的交付与服务能力
建议优先判断这支团队有没有做过与你相似的项目,而不是只看公司规模。
更有价值的问题包括:
- 做过哪些相近行业和仓型
- 是否有对接类似 ERP、MES、WCS 的经验
- 是否能提供现场试运行支持
- 售后响应和问题闭环机制是什么
如果项目需要长期迭代,那么供应商是否具备持续服务能力,比首轮报价更重要。
四、一个更稳妥的选型流程
下面这套流程比较适合中型及以上仓储项目:
第一步:做现场盘点
不要直接发 RFP。先把仓库现场的基本情况盘清楚:
- 仓库数量、面积、作业班次
- 日常单量与峰值波动
- SKU 数、批次要求、序列号要求
- 现有系统、现有设备、现有表单
- 当前最明显的效率或准确率问题
第二步:列出项目范围清单
把这次必须交付的内容列成清单,并区分:
- 本次必须上线
- 可以二期处理
- 目前不纳入范围
范围清单越清晰,后面选型越容易对比。
第三步:组织场景化演示
不要只看 PPT 和通用产品演示。建议供应商按你的仓库场景来演示。
例如:
- 原料收货到上架
- 电商波次到复核出库
- 盘点差异处理
- 与 ERP 或 MES 的单据回传
第四步:做小范围验证
如果项目复杂,建议安排 POC 或最小场景验证。验证的重点不是全部功能,而是几个高风险点:
- 关键流程是否跑得通
- 数据口径是否一致
- PDA 作业是否顺手
- 接口链路是否稳定
第五步:把合同和实施计划一起确认
只签软件采购而不把实施计划、范围和责任写清楚,后续争议会非常大。
至少要明确:
- 交付范围
- 双方责任
- 关键里程碑
- 验收口径
- 变更机制
五、常见误区
误区 1:只比功能,不看实施
WMS 项目成败往往不取决于“有没有 100 个功能”,而取决于核心流程能否稳定上线。
误区 2:希望一步解决所有问题
如果企业同时想完成流程重组、系统替换、自动化对接、主数据治理和报表升级,项目复杂度会非常高。更稳妥的做法是分阶段推进。
误区 3:低估接口工作量
接口往往决定项目节奏。单据状态、字段口径、异常处理和责任归属,通常都比预想中更复杂。
误区 4:忽略上线切换准备
上线不是把系统打开就结束,还包括库存核对、人员培训、试运行和异常预案。
六、给评估阶段的一个实用清单
如果你正在启动 WMS 选型,建议先把下面这些问题回答出来:
- 当前仓库最想解决的 3 个问题是什么
- 本次上线包含哪些仓、哪些流程
- 需要对接哪些系统和设备
- 哪些数据已经准备好,哪些还没有
- 谁来负责业务决策、接口对接和现场推进
- 希望分几期上线,每期目标是什么
这些问题比“哪家报价更低”更能决定项目质量。
结语
WMS 选型不是一次软件采购动作,而是一次仓储执行体系的重建过程。
真正合适的方案,通常不是“功能最多”的那个,而是:
- 边界清楚
- 场景贴合
- 实施路径现实
- 接口责任明确
- 上线节奏可控
如果前期把这些问题想清楚,后续实施会顺得多;如果前期只比价格和功能,后面往往要用更高的成本补课。